Ghana's qualifying campaign was spearheaded by Mohammed Kudus, whose goal sealed top spot — though Kudus is now ruled out of the tournament through injury. Captain Jordan Ayew leads the squad, now managed by Carlos Queiroz (appointed April 2026). Antoine Semenyo (Manchester City) and Inaki Williams (Athletic Bilbao) provide wide attacking options. Group L against England and Croatia will be formidable.

Path to qualification

Qualified by winning CAF Group I with 25 points, clinching the spot with a 1-0 win over Comoros (Mohammed Kudus goal).
